The Queen and Prince Harry are stated to still have a very exceptional bond.
A royal insider has claimed that the Queen still 'adores' her grandson Prince Harry notwithstanding the Duke and Duchess of Sussex's exit from royal life.
It's been claimed that while Prince Harry's relationships with Prince Charles and Prince William are thinking to be strained, the Duke of Sussex's bond with his grandmother, the Queen, is nevertheless strong.
After disposing of himself and his family from the royal highlight in 2020, Prince Harry opened up about the struggles he had faced with his brother and father in light of the controversial selection in the course of his and Meghan's bombshell Oprah Winfrey interview.
Harry informed of how Prince Charles stopped taking his smartphone calls when he first stepped away, including that he felt "really let down" by way of his dad.
And having admitted that he and Prince William are "on specific paths", it is been said that Harry and Her Majesty's relationship is nonetheless thriving.



"If Harry asks, the Queen would say yes. She adores him," PEOPLE says a royal family pal revealed.
Meanwhile, Prince Harry recently shared an perception into his most latest assembly with the Queen after he and Meghan stopped off in the UK before heading to The Netherlands for the Invictus Games.
Chatting about meeting up for tea with his grandmother, Harry confessed she is still as impressed by his jokes as ever.
Speaking to TODAY, Harry said, "It was great. It used to be so nice to see her. She's on extremely good form, she's usually obtained a wonderful sense of humour with me."
